Sean Taro Ono Lennon ; born October 9, 1975 is an American singer, songwriter, musician, guitarist and actor of English, Japanese and Irish Descent. He is the only child of John Lennon and Yoko Ono and the younger half-brother of Julian Lennon. His godfather is Sir Elton John. Sean Lennon was born in New York City on October 9, 1975, his father's 35th birthday. Julian Lennon is his half-brother and Kyoko Chan Cox is his half-sister. Grand Royal

Grand Royal was the Los Angeles, California based vanity record label set up in 1992 by the Beastie Boys in conjunction with Capitol Records after the group left Def Jam Recordings.
